Abstract

Enterprises equipped with IoT (Internet of Things) are the new generation of manufacturing industry. There is a need for new optimization models which incorporate the advantages of IoT. In this paper, a new mathematical model and heuristic algorithm are developed to minimize the total cost in a multiple machine environment which enables the industries to take economically better decisions and effectively use their resources. A heuristic algorithm is developed for identical machines which process with the same tool. A system in which jobs with stochastic workloads arrive randomly and upon arrival, their workload is facilitated by IoT. The proposed algorithm determines the assignment of workload to the machine and processing speed. The algorithm works for both online and offline frameworks.
